How might we save water doing basic activities?

My General Ideas

water collect fan: collect the water vapor generated from the hot water when taking showers through fans. Reuse the water again and avoid the wet walls.

water vacuum collector: an idea combined with vacuum cleaner. Collect the water left on the sides and the bottom of bathtub through the holes inside the bathtub.

water reuse system: collect the waste water from sink, bathtub, washing machine, and reuse these water to flush toilet.

sink with multiply water faucet: reversal idea

water usage reminder: reminders you can put on any appliance that using water to reminder how much water you have used. Including information, gallons of water used per water, total amount water you used, the number of days which those amount water can keep you alive.

vapor washing machine: use water vapor to clean dirty clothes in order to save 99% water and kill most of bacterias.

dishwasher that using separate small areas: the user doesn’t have save dirty disks for many days. Even a few amount of disks, you can choose the area you want to clean in the dishwasher.

New Warm-up Game

I called this game “action freeze”. Group members stand together and form a circle. The first person in the group starting the game count backwards from 5 and covers his eyes with hands. During this five-second period, other people in the group have to pick their own difficult action and act before the first person opens his eyes. Then he will judge and picks out a guy who is doing an easy action or moving. Then that guy become the person who starts next turn.

Session Organization

I invited four people, Michael, Eric, Sara and Jim into my session. Three are students, one is a boss of a pizza restaurant.

Background: Michael is a graduated student who is studying and doing researches in the field of Chemical Enginnering. Eric is a sophomore student whose major is electrical engineering. Sara is also a sophomore student who study in biology. And Jim is the boss of the pizza restaurant. I think Micheal and Sara’s backgrounds have some relationships to my topic: water usage. Also, Jim has to manage the water used inside his restaurant, thus his job is absolutely connected to water.

Settings: As the person holding the session, my major job is collecting and repeating the ideas generated in the brainstorm. As for others, they are participants in my session.

Firstly, I introduced them to each other and explained what we are going to do specificly to them. And we started playing some warm up games.

After warmup games, I gave my group about 10 minutes to discuss the topic with their own understanding and share the ideas they already had. (I told them to generate some ideas about “how might save water doing basic activities” two or three days before the session started.)

Then I let them to sketch those ideas with 15 minutes after exchanging ideas with others. And that is the phase 1.

In the phase 2, I introduced the method of rolestorming which let them to imagine themselves as different identities even superheros. It came up with a bunch of interesting ideas over that 5 minutes.

Next in the phase 3, I introduced the method of negative brainstorming which let them to find ways how to waste water. I also gave 5minutes to my group in that section.

At the last phase 4, I combined the methods of brute think and props together. I asked them to pick up a random word from PPT firstly, then pick up a random object from the surrounding. We spent about 3 minutes in this phase. I think the time used is perfect, because I promised them the session would not last longer than 40 minutes and they found it was kind of hard to generate ideas on that topic after phase 123.

Top Ideas

Water usage reminder(Sara): reminders you can put on any appliance that using water to reminder how much water you have used. Including information, gallons of water used per water, total amount water you used, the number of days which those amount water can keep you alive.

This idea/product is good for those housewifes.

water collector in the car(Sara):

when snowing and raining, the collectors in the car will collect and filtrate water. When we drive back home, you can take those water tanks out and use the water inside.

This product is good for those people who have a car and drive a lot outside.

Steam Shower(Jim):

Use high pressure but low temperature steam to clean your body. This steam shower capsule can save 99% water and even can help people get rid of soaps!

This product is designed for those people take long time showers.

Snow or rain water collector for house(Sara):

When raining or snowing, water will flow into the huge water tank under the house through roof and pipes. The filter will basically clean the water. The heater on the roof will melt the snow in the winter.

This one can be applied to anywhere, especially for those family in water shortage areas.

sewage recycle machine(Michael):

collect all the sewage inside house then filtrate and distill it, finally get the pure water.

This one can be applied to anywhere, especially for those family in water shortage areas.

Range hood that separate oil and steam(Eric):

A range hood that can separate the oil&smoke and steam when you cook at home. Save steam and turn it into water.

This product is good for housewife who loves cooking a lot.

High efficient water spray for garden(Sara):

A better design for sprays in the garden which makes them use water much more efficiently.

automatic flowering flowerpot that use rain water(Jim):

A flowerpot that can save water when raining, and it will flower the plants automatically.

human shape bathtub(Eric):

a bathtub that designed as a human shape. It saves a lot of water unnecessarily used during a shower. You just need to lie in the bathtub and get up, then you are clean.

This product is designed for those people take long time showers.

Humidifier plants(Sara):

A kind of plants that can adjust the water inside the room. When the environment becomes dry, the plant will release water into the air.
